But, finding the perfect koi pond in your a...The difference in the maximum and retention elevations in the pond is the detention volume. With this method, the detention volume is stacked on the retention volume. Both wet and dry ponds can be configured in this way. A detention pond, also known as a dry pond, has an orifice level at the bottom of the basin but no permanent pool of water. All the water evaporates between storms, and the area is usually dry. Use a riser and orifice at a higher point to keep a persistent pool of water in a retention basin or pond. A retention pond …Retention basin in Pinnau, Schleswig-Holstein, Germany. Detention and retention basins are frequently used as a stormwater runoff best management practice to provide general flood protection, lessen extreme floods, and improve water quality (if …The Difference Between a Detention and a Retention Basin. A detention basin/pond temporarily stores stormwater runoff. The basin is designed to manage stormwater runoff by storing it and releasing it gradually until completed drained.
